  • Question 3
    1 / -0

    Name the state of matter that ‘has minimum inter-particle force of attraction’

    Solution

    Explanation:

    The particles of gases are away from each other. So, gas has the minimum inter-particle force of attraction.
    Solids have maximum force of attraction

  • Question 7
    1 / -0

    The room temperature on Celsius scale is 250C. What is the temperature on the Kelvin scale?

    Solution

    K=C + 273, 25C = 273 + 25 = 298K. So, temperature of 25C is equal to 298K.
